A … Web10 feb. 2024 · The average credit score in the U.S. is 716.¹. The average credit score for Americans ages 23 to 29 is 660.². 80- to 89-year-olds have the highest average credit score of 757.². Low-income families have a median credit score of 658.³. Asian Americans have the highest credit score of any race at 745.⁴. WebTo illustrate this, as of Nov. 1, 2024, the average mortgage APR in the U.S. was approximately 7.1%. Borrowers with a 760 FICO Score or higher received an average APR of 6.61%, while those in the 700-759 range had an average APR of 6.83%. Again, there are several factors in addition to your credit score that a mortgage lender will look at.
